Neighborhood Overview
Forest Lake Golf Club is situated in Ocoee, a growing city west of Orlando, Florida. The club is easily accessible via major roadways, with State Road 429 (Western Beltway) and State Road 50 (Colonial Drive) being the primary arteries for reaching the area. Ocoee offers a blend of suburban tranquility and convenient access to the amenities of the larger Orlando metropolitan area. Parking at the golf club is ample, primarily consisting of dedicated lots near the clubhouse, designed to accommodate golfers and event guests. For those flying in, Orlando International Airport (MCO) is the closest major airport, located approximately 25-30 miles east of Ocoee. Driving times from the airport can vary significantly based on traffic, typically ranging from 35 to 55 minutes. Public transportation options are limited in this specific area, making rideshare services or personal vehicles the most practical modes of transport for reaching the club. Smart arrival tactics include planning your journey during off-peak hours if possible, especially on weekend mornings or during tournament days, to avoid any potential traffic congestion on local roads like Clarcona Ocoee Road.

West Orange Trail
3.5 miThis paved multi-use trail stretches for over 20 miles through Orange County, offering a fantastic route for biking, jogging, walking, and inline skating. The section near Ocoee and Winter Garden is particularly scenic, passing by lakes, through charming downtown areas, and alongside natural Florida landscapes. Numerous access points make it easy to hop on for a short ride or a longer excursion. It's a perfect choice for active visitors looking to experience the local environment and get some exercise in a safe, car-free setting. Rentals are available in Winter Garden.
Downtown Winter Garden
4.0 miJust a short drive from Forest Lake Golf Club, Downtown Winter Garden offers a vibrant and historic atmosphere. The area boasts a beautifully restored historic downtown with a variety of boutique shops, art galleries, and a lively farmers market on Saturdays. Along Plant Street, visitors can find unique cafes, breweries, and restaurants, creating a charming destination for an afternoon stroll or an evening out. The West Orange Trail also runs through the heart of downtown, making it a central hub for both local life and visitor exploration.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Ocoee typically brings mild and dry conditions, with average highs in the 60s and 70s Fahrenheit. Mornings can be crisp, sometimes requiring a light jacket or long sleeves for early tee times. You’ll find the golf course to be in excellent condition, and this season is very comfortable for walking the course. Pack layers to adjust to temperature fluctuations throughout the day, but heavy winter gear is rarely necessary.
Spring & early summer
As spring transitions into early summer, temperatures begin to rise, with highs often reaching the 80s and low 90s Fahrenheit. Humidity increases, and the chance of afternoon thunderstorms becomes more frequent. Lightweight, breathable clothing is essential. Players should be prepared for both sunny skies and sudden rain showers, and early morning rounds are advisable to avoid the peak heat and potential storms.
Mid-summer
July and August are the hottest and most humid months, with daily highs consistently in the low to mid-90s Fahrenheit, often feeling hotter with the humidity. Afternoon thunderstorms are a daily occurrence, usually developing rapidly. Golfers should focus on staying hydrated, wearing sun protection, and planning rounds to be completed before the typical storm window. Lightweight, moisture-wicking fabrics are a must.
Fall season
Fall offers a return to more comfortable weather, with temperatures gradually cooling from the summer heat. Highs are typically in the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it, and humidity levels decrease. This season provides excellent conditions for golf, with clear skies and pleasant breezes becoming more common. It’s a great time for extended rounds and enjoying the outdoor aspects of the club and surrounding areas.
Rain & snow
Rain is common, especially during the summer months in the form of pop-up thunderstorms that can cause temporary course closures and delays. Snow is exceptionally rare in this region and not a factor for planning golf visits. Visitors should always check the forecast before arrival and be prepared for potential weather-related disruptions, particularly during the warmer half of the year. Umbrellas and waterproofs are advisable during the rainy season.
